Output 305d6e7ef65b90b3acd272e5410c93d6b7200c7d0e5d90d34883e19ea986d180:437

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e23b5ca37bb47417965dc000ac74c3e04eed4f947a5626140bbd4ca72f834cf4
address
bc1puga4egmmk36p09jacqq2caxrup8w6nu50ftzv9qth4x2wturfn6qhdyjlr
transaction
305d6e7ef65b90b3acd272e5410c93d6b7200c7d0e5d90d34883e19ea986d180
confirmations
11892
spent
true